2016-11-22 57 views
1

有沒有什麼辦法可以在運行時檢查我的RCP應用程序是首次安裝(通過Webstart)還是從緩存(例如,桌面快捷方式)運行。 我想到的是實現DownloadServiceListener,並檢查是否有一個靜態資源被下載(如果是 - 新建,如果沒有 - 緩存)。確定新安裝或緩存RCP應用程序

回答

1

使用JNLP的installer-desc元素調用某些代碼,該代碼在PesistenceService中寫入屬性。查看更多關於JNLP API的信息。

+0

謝謝。它對我的問題很好,但我意識到,其實它不是我想問的,對不起。我想知道Webstart何時從快捷方式或從新的JNLP運行。當我點擊新的JNLP文件時,它可能沒有必要再次安裝,因爲它的緩存。 –

相關問題